WebNorthern Ireland Map. Northern Ireland is a part of the United Kingdom. It occupies the northern part of the island of Ireland and has a surface area of 14,130 km2. The train journey time between Northern Ireland and Ireland is around 2h 21m and covers a distance of around 182 km. This includes an average layover time of around 5 min. Operated by Irish Rail, the Northern Ireland to Ireland train service departs from Belfast Central and arrives in Dublin Pearse. impact advisors reviewsWebMap of Ireland with places to visit. Carrickfergus Castle is arguably Northern Ireland’s most famous castle. Dating back to 1177, the castle is in pristine condition and it boasts a postcard-worthy location right on the water. impact-ad.jp うざい
